The present invention relates to a horizontal ratchet feed finger for operation upon practically all types of automatic saw grinders and is desired for carrying the saw teeth under the emery with an even motion without any danger of injuring the teeth by dulling the sharpened edges thereof.
Another very important feature of the invention resides in the provision of a structure of this nature which releases around the teeth rather than over the ends thereof as is the common practice.
A still further very important object of the invention resides in the provision of a horizontal feed finger of this nature which is exceedingly simple in its construction, strong and durable, and thoroughly efiicient and reliable in use and operation.

Referring to the drawing in detail it will be seen that the numeral 5 denotes a knuckle including a body wit-h one end thickened and provided with an opening 6 extending from side to side and having a bushing 7 therein to form a bearing for re ceiving the wrist pin 8 of a suitable rocker 9.
Conventional adjusting means 10 is associated with the head of the rocker to control the wrist pin 8. The other end at the 1928. Serial No. 280,451.
knuckle 5 is extended downwardly and provided with a notch 11. Adjacent this other end a knuckle is provided with an opening 12 for loosely receiving a vertical stud bolt 13 which is anchored as will be hereinafter claimed.
A pair of stud bolts 14 are threaded through the knuckle between the openings 6 and 12 and adjacent/the latter and may be locked in adjusted position by means of jam nuts 15. A U-shaped plate 16 is disposed over the intermediate portion of the knuckle 5 and the bolts 13 and 14 extend through openings therein.
A yoke 17 comprises a; substantially rectangular body with an' opening 18 adjacent one end and a pair of longitudinally spaced openings 19 intermediate its ends and an opening 20 adjacent its other end for threadedly receiving the stud bolt 13 and from said other end there extends a tongue 21 into the notch 11.
The ends of the plate 16 terminate to the sides of this yoke to prevent-lateral play of the knuckles and'theyoke'inrelation to each other. A spring 22 is'disposed about the. 1
bolt 13 impinging against the he'ad 13 thereof at its upper end and against the plate 16 to urge theknu'ckle downwardly toward the yoke, it being noted that the studlbolts 14 engage or'bear' against the yoke 17 to space the bearing *endporti'onof the knuckle from the yoke the desired distance against the action of the spring 22.
The numeral 24 denotes'an elongated arm provided intermediate its ends with a longitudinally spaced opening 25 to receive bolts 26 which extends through the opening 18 to rockably mount the arm on the yoke so that said arm-may swing in a horizontal plane.
A transverse slot'27 is formed in the arm edge thereof and from the opposite side edge of the yoke 17 there depends a stud 31. The tongue and stud are provided with pins 32 pro ecting toward eachbther.
The ends of a coil spring 33 are d sposed about stems s2 and i inge aghast the stud 31 and the tongue 30 to normally hold the arm longitudinally'alined with the yoke, it being seen that the arm may be rocked to the limit afforded by the pin and slot connection provided by bolt 28 and slot 27.
Under the free end of the arm 24 there is mounted a longitudinaly extending shoe 34 adj ustably mounted by means of bolts 35 extending through transverse slots 36 formed in the arm 24. This shoe is adapted to engage against a stop pin 37 or the like pro vided on the platform 38 of the automatic grinder.
A key 39 of trapezoidal cross sectional formation is slidable in a transverse channel 40 provided on the upper face of the free end of the arm 24 being of dove tailed formation. One end of this key 39 is beveled inwardly toward the pivoted end of the arm. From the above detailed description it will be seen that as the rocker 9 swings in the direction of the arrow 43 in Figure 1 the grinder 44, of course, is out of engagement with the saw 4.5 and the key 39 is engaged with its beveled end 41 between two or the teeth of the saw 45 thereby causing the saw to advance and then as the rocker moves in an opposite direction to arrow 43 the beveled end 41 will cause the arm 24 to swing in the direction of the arrow- 4L6 in Figure 2 so as to pass around the tooth of the saw ratherthan over the toothof the saw and in this way the movement of thekey will n no way dull the tooth which has ust been sharpened.
The connection between the knuckle and the yoke afiorded by the bolt 13 with its spring 22 compensates for the arcuate movement of the head of the rocker 9 and tends to more firmly hold the key in engagement with the saw as it is advancing the saw as will be apparent.
This tension, of course may be ad usted by the stud bolts 14. With this device t is possible to obtain an even stroke at all times without any danger of inJuring, dulling or otherwise detrimentally afiecting the saw teeth.
